- The distance between Mpika, Zambia and Turiacu, Brazil is approximately 8,536 km or 5,304 mi.
- To reach Mpika in this distance one would set out from Turiacu bearing 101.8° or ESE and follow the great circles arc to approach Mpika bearing 91° or E .
- Mpika has a humid subtropical climate with dry winters (Cwa) whereas Turiacu has a tropical monsoonal climate (Am).
- Mpika is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ome whereas Turiacu is in or near the tropical moist forest biome.
- The mean temperature is 6.3 °C (11.3°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 5.8 °C (10.4°F) more in Mpika.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to extremely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1155.2 mm (45.5 in) less which is equivalent to 1155.2 l/m² (28.35 US gal/ft²) or 11,552,000 l/ha (1,234,985 US gal/ac) less. About 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 2.3° lower in Mpika than in Turiacu.
- Relative humidity levels are 17.1%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 10.8°C (19.5°F) lower.
